Abstract:
Objective To develop a method for residual organic solvent determination in 18F-fluoroacetate(18F-FAC) using capillary gas chromatography.
Methods The residual organic solvents were separated on the HP-INNOWAX capillary chromatographic column using temperature programming. Nitrogen gas was used as the carrier gas, along with a flame ionization detector(FID). The FID and injector temperatures were 270℃ and 200℃, respectively, and the injection volume was 1 μl.
Results Good linear relationships in the experimental concentrations(r=0.9999, 0.9973, 0.9988) were observed. The three residual organic solvents were separated completely; the average recoveries were 99.8%, 101.0%, and 97.5%, and the relative standard deviation values were 4.6%, 4.0%, and 1.5%, respectively.
Conclusion The proposed method is simple, rapid, accurate, and highly sensitive, which can be used in detecting residual organic solvents in 18F-FAC.
